Fire Rescue News - Officials believe fire displacing four in Pleasantville started with child playing with lighter

A child playing with a lighter in his bedroom is believed to be the cause of an accidental fire in Pleasantville that displaced four people, the fire department said.

Fire Capt. Charles Freeman said that the fire was reported at 5 p.m. at a single family ranch on the 1100 block of Iowa Avenue. Two engines and a ladder truck were soon on the scene, Freeman said, and the fire was under control by 5:10. The Northfield and Farmington fire departments assisted.

Three adults and the juvenile were displaced by the fire, Freeman said. They were being assisted by the Red Cross.

Fire Rescue News - Pleasantville fire starts in home's basement, displaces family

Four people were forced from their East Edgewater Avenue home Saturday afternoon after a fire started in their basement.

Firefighters from Pleasantville, Egg Harbor Township, Northfield and Absecon responded to the blaze at about 3:45 p.m. and had it under control about a half hour later, the Pleasantville Fire Department said.

The Red Cross is taking care of the family while authorities investigate the incident, firefighters said. No people or animals were injured.
